ABOUT
The Coordinator, Center for Anatomy and Physiology, is responsible for operating and maintaining the Center for Anatomy and Physiology (CAP). This includes, but is not limited to, maintaining inventory, ordering equipment and disposable materials, and ensuring the cleanliness of the CAP.
WHAT YOU WILL DO
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S and DUTIES
- Responsible for creating the Fall, Spring, and Summer schedules for the CAP. Schedules will be finalized by the Department Chair of Life Sciences.
- Responsible for securing substitutes to ensure adequate coverage of the CAP room is maintained and accessible for students.
- Work cooperatively with faculty members and tutors in an effort to contribute to the overall instructional effectiveness of the CAP.
- Manage student tutors, as necessary, to assure the CAP Resource Schedule is maintained.
- Provide 40 hours of tutoring per week, in the CAP.
- Tutor students during one-to-one appointments in the CAP room and online to identify and address understanding of subject content.
- Guide and support students toward independent learning by suggesting and modeling study skills and proper practices for college success.
- Keep precise records of student visits/no shows.
- Reflect and improve upon tutoring techniques by researching tutoring methods during downtime.
- Report problems to the Department Chair of Life Sciences.
- Ensure that the center continues to function as a safe learning space for students.
Cross-Train with Laboratory Coordinators to offer support of prepping labs when necessary.

WHO YOU ARE
Required Education
Bachelor’s Degree in life sciences or a related field
Required Experience
Two years of related experience
Preferred Education
Master’s Degree with 18 hours in the life sciences area
Additional Job-Specific Requirements
- Knowledge of and experience with standard laboratory equipment
- Knowledge of current laboratory methods and of basic first-aid procedures
- Must maintain a high level of confidentiality
